Gingerbread Man Lacing Fine Motor Activity
This gingerbread man lacing activity is a great preschool fine motor activity, especially during the Winter season. Download and print your free lacing printable today to work on your child’s fine motor development.
Fine motor activities are not just for babies and toddlers! This activity will help your preschooler work on their fine motor development, hand-eye coordination, and more.
The concentration my son displays while doing these is really remarkable. It’s a tedious job for little fingers, and it can be a bit frustrating for him at times. But with breaks and encouragement, he usually makes it almost all the way around.
The good thing about these printable lacing activities (like my Autumn leaf lacing) is that they’re pretty customizable. You can punch as many holes in the edges as you like! You can even write numbers on different ones to make it more challenging as they grow.

Gingerbread Man Lacing Fine Motor Activity for Preschoolers
At this point, I punch a lot of holes for my son to weave the yarn through. When my toddler starts doing these, I’ll reprint them and punch about half as many, so she doesn’t get overwhelmed or easily frustrated.
